Quick Summary

The U.S. Army Contracting Command-Redstone is conducting market research via a Request for Information (RFI) to identify potential sources for environmental system maintenance and repair/replacement services at the TMDE Support Center, Letterkenny Army Depot, Chambersburg, PA. These services are crucial for maintaining laboratory environmental systems used in calibrating sensitive scientific equipment. Responses are due March 31, 2026.

Scope of Work

The requirement involves comprehensive maintenance, repair, and replacement of laboratory environmental systems. Key tasks include:

  • Replacing four (4) evaporators on existing indoor units.
  • Replacing four (4) condensing units.
  • Replacing rooftop units, requiring crane operations.
  • Upgrading existing Temperature/Humidity Controllers with new PLC Controllers for each of the four labs.
  • Housing PLC controllers in new 24x24 NEMA Enclosures.
  • Providing a new standalone PC with VT SCADA for monitoring, trending, and data storage.
  • Programming PLCs to match existing HVAC controls.
  • Installing new control panels and interfacing with existing equipment.
  • Performing startup and training for the new control system. The Performance Work Statement (PWS) also specifies deliverables such as a written summary of laboratory conditions and environmental certification records.

Submission Requirements

Interested parties should submit responses via email to the listed points of contact. Responses must include:

  • Full company name
  • Business size and applicable socio-economic status
  • Points of Contact (name, position, office, phone, email)
  • CAGE Code
  • Unique Entity Identifier (UEI)

Additional Notes

This RFI is for information and planning purposes only and does not constitute a solicitation or commitment to award a contract. Responses are voluntary and will not be compensated. Potential offerors are responsible for monitoring SAM.gov for any future solicitations. Contractor employees will be subject to installation access, background checks, and personal identity verification requirements.
